欧文十大数据库平台是什么
-
欧文(Open Web Engineering)是一个开放的数据库平台,提供了许多功能强大的数据库平台。以下是欧文十大数据库平台:
-
MySQL:MySQL是最受欢迎的开源关系型数据库管理系统之一。它具有高性能、稳定性和可靠性,适用于各种规模的应用程序。
-
PostgreSQL:PostgreSQL是另一个流行的开源关系型数据库管理系统,被广泛用于大规模、高性能的应用程序。它支持复杂的查询和数据类型,并具有强大的扩展性。
-
MongoDB:MongoDB是一个面向文档的NoSQL数据库,它以其灵活的数据模型和可伸缩性而闻名。它适用于处理大量的非结构化数据。
-
Redis:Redis是一个内存存储和数据结构服务器,常用于缓存、会话管理和实时分析等场景。它支持多种数据类型,并具有快速的读写能力。
-
Cassandra:Cassandra是一个分布式NoSQL数据库,用于处理大规模、高可用性的数据。它具有良好的水平扩展性和容错性,适用于大数据处理和实时分析。
-
Elasticsearch:Elasticsearch是一个开源的分布式搜索和分析引擎,用于处理大规模的实时数据。它具有强大的全文搜索能力和灵活的数据聚合功能。
-
Neo4j:Neo4j是一个图形数据库,专注于处理复杂的关系数据。它使用图形结构来存储数据,并提供了强大的图形查询和分析功能。
-
SQLite:SQLite是一个嵌入式关系型数据库,适用于轻量级应用程序和移动设备。它具有小巧、高效和易于使用的特点。
-
Apache HBase:HBase是一个分布式列式存储数据库,建立在Hadoop之上。它适用于高速读写和随机访问的大规模数据集。
-
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统,广泛用于企业级应用程序。它具有丰富的功能和可靠的性能。
这些数据库平台都在各自领域具有广泛的应用,可以满足不同应用程序的需求。无论是小型网站还是大型企业级应用,都可以根据具体需求选择适合的数据库平台。
3个月前 -
-
欧文(Open Web Interface for Neutron)是一个开放的网络接口,用于与OpenStack网络服务Neutron进行交互。它提供了一种标准的方式来管理和配置网络资源,包括虚拟机实例的网络连接、子网、路由器等。在OpenStack中,Neutron是一个关键的组件,负责虚拟化网络的管理和配置。
在Neutron中,有许多数据库平台被用来存储和管理网络相关的信息。以下是欧文十大数据库平台:
-
MySQL:MySQL是一种常用的关系型数据库管理系统,广泛用于Neutron中存储网络的配置信息、状态信息等。
-
PostgreSQL:PostgreSQL是另一种常用的关系型数据库管理系统,也被用于Neutron中存储网络相关的信息。
-
SQLite:SQLite是一种轻量级的关系型数据库,常用于嵌入式系统中。在某些小规模的部署中,Neutron也可以使用SQLite来存储网络信息。
-
MongoDB:MongoDB是一种非关系型数据库,适用于存储大量的非结构化数据。在一些大规模的Neutron部署中,MongoDB可以作为数据库平台来存储网络信息。
-
Redis:Redis是一种高性能的键值对存储数据库,常用于缓存和临时数据存储。在一些性能要求较高的Neutron部署中,Redis可以作为数据库平台来存储网络信息。
-
Cassandra:Cassandra是一种分布式的非关系型数据库,适用于存储大规模的分布式数据。在一些高可用性和可伸缩性要求较高的Neutron部署中,Cassandra可以作为数据库平台来存储网络信息。
-
Oracle Database:Oracle Database是一种商业化的关系型数据库管理系统,也被一些Neutron部署中使用。
-
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统,也被一些Neutron部署中使用。
-
MariaDB:MariaDB是MySQL的一个分支,提供了更多的功能和性能优化。一些Neutron部署中也会选择使用MariaDB作为数据库平台。
-
Amazon Aurora:Amazon Aurora是亚马逊开发的关系型数据库管理系统,专为云环境设计。在一些使用亚马逊云服务的Neutron部署中,可以选择使用Amazon Aurora作为数据库平台。
以上是欧文十大数据库平台,根据实际需求和环境,可以选择适合的数据库平台来存储和管理Neutron中的网络相关信息。
3个月前 -
-
欧文(Ovum)是一家全球知名的市场研究和咨询公司,专注于信息技术领域。他们在2019年发布了一份关于数据库平台的报告,列出了他们认为是十大数据库平台的公司。下面是这十大数据库平台的介绍和特点:
-
Oracle:作为全球最大的数据库供应商之一,Oracle提供了一系列的数据库产品,包括Oracle Database、MySQL和NoSQL数据库。它具有强大的性能、可靠性和扩展性,广泛应用于企业级应用和大型数据处理。
-
Microsoft:Microsoft的SQL Server是一种流行的关系型数据库,适用于中小型企业和个人用户。它具有良好的可管理性和易用性,并与其他Microsoft产品无缝集成。
-
IBM:IBM的DB2数据库是一种功能强大且可靠的数据库平台,适用于大型企业和复杂的应用。它具有高度的可扩展性和安全性,并且支持多种操作系统和编程语言。
-
SAP:SAP的HANA数据库是一种内存计算数据库,具有快速的性能和高度的可扩展性。它特别适用于大规模的实时分析和处理。
-
Amazon:亚马逊的AWS(Amazon Web Services)提供了多种数据库服务,包括关系型数据库(如Amazon RDS和Amazon Aurora)和NoSQL数据库(如Amazon DynamoDB)。它具有高度的可伸缩性和灵活性,并且可以根据需求进行弹性扩展。
-
Google:Google的Cloud Spanner是一种全球分布式关系型数据库,具有强大的一致性和可用性。它适用于需要高度可扩展性和全球部署的应用。
-
MongoDB:MongoDB是一种流行的NoSQL数据库,适用于处理半结构化和非结构化数据。它具有灵活的数据模型和高度的可伸缩性,并且支持分布式部署。
-
Teradata:Teradata是一种专门用于大数据分析的关系型数据库平台。它具有强大的并行处理能力和高度的可扩展性,适用于复杂的分析和查询。
-
Informatica:Informatica提供了一系列的数据集成和管理工具,用于将数据从各种来源整合到数据库中。它具有强大的数据清洗和转换功能,并且支持多种数据源和目标。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库,具有成熟的功能和广泛的社区支持。它适用于各种规模的应用,并且可以与其他开源工具和框架无缝集成。
以上十大数据库平台各具特色,适用于不同的应用场景和需求。选择合适的数据库平台需要考虑因素包括数据量、性能要求、可靠性、安全性、成本等。
3个月前 -